Pacific Rim: Uprising has now premiered in Japan, as giant robots battle kaiju to save the Earth. Now, the Guillermo del Toro-produced film has teamed up with Mazinger Z Infinity for a special collaboration artwork. It features Mazinger Z with Gypsy Avenger, as well as the other Jaegers from Pacific Rim: Uprising. Oh, and there’s also a kaijuu in the artwork as well.

And speaking of kaiju, how about a team-up with the King of Monsters itself, Godzilla? And yes, Pacific Rim: Uprising also collaborated with the Godzilla anime for a collaboration artwork.

As the visual has shown, Godzilla: City on the Edge of Battle premieres in Japanese theatres on 18th May. Meanwhile, the second Pacific Rim film premiered in the country last 13th April. Hidetaka Tenjin, who works as the Godzilla anime’s designer, illustrated the collaboration artwork.

Finally, acclaimed robot anime director and mecha designer, Masami Obari, also contributed his own official artwork for the film.
